#d729f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d729f4 is composed of 84.3% red, 16.1%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.9% cyan, 83.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 291.4 degrees, a saturation of 90.2% and a lightness of 55.9%. #d729f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ff52ff with #af00e9.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

#d729f4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d729f4 has RGB values of R:215, G:41,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0.83,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 14100980.

Shades and Tints of #d729f4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09010a is the darkest color, while #fdf6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d729f4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#938895 is the less saturated color, while #dd20fd is the most saturated one.
